Build-A-Bear Workshop (BBW) reported Q4 EPS of $1.30, $0.18 better than the analyst estimate of $1.12. Revenue for the quarter came in at $145.1 million versus the consensus estimate of $137.54 million.
GUIDANCE:
- Total revenues to increase in the range of 5% to 7% compared to fiscal 2022 with growth in all three operating segments;
- Pre-tax income growth of 10% to 15% compared to fiscal 2022, surpassing the record high that the Company achieved in fiscal 2022;
- To open 20 to 30 experience locations, through a combination of third-party retail and corporately-managed business models, with the majority planned for the second half of the year;
- Capital expenditures in the range of $15 million to $20 million;
- Depreciation and amortization of approximately $13 million to $14 million; and
- Tax rate to approximate 25% excluding discrete items.
